Rims: difference in ride quality 18 vs 19
Is there a difference in ride quality between a 18" rim with a 225/40 tire and a 19" rim with a 225/35 tire? I'm about to order wheels, and am still up in the air about this topic.
04XType is right 19x7.5 and below do not rub. I had 215/35/19 on 19x8 wheels and they didnt rub but the ride quality sucked, not to mention being more prone to pothole damage. I upgraded to some 225/35/19 and the ride quality is a 100% and it looks more aggressive as well. (Check out my cardomain in my sig)
I've been in an X-Type w/ 18's and the ride feels close to stock, and with my X w/ the 19's you could definitley feel more bumps in the road. I guess it's just one of the sacrifices I make for the look that I want.

hey gotti, whats your wheel offset? thats the most important detail to prevent rubbing, i.e. mine are 38mm, and they rub. im guessing yours are like 42+mm.
I have 19x8's wrapped in 225/35/19 tires on my x-type sport with lowered H&R springs and Bilstein sport struts, and have absolutely no rubbing. it's an absolute perfect fit. my offset is +42.
